Energy & Change

AnswerQuestions
Ability to cause change Energy
energy ability to cause change
solar energy energy produced by the sun
electrical energy carries charges in the form of shocks, lightning, and electricity,
Heat energy eneryg og particles constantly moving
mechanical energy energy of moving objects
circuit a path where electricity flows through
closed circuit charges flow throught wire and light bulb turns on
open circuit charges cannot flw through wire and light bulb is turned off.
radiation movement of heat energy in form of waves
conduction movement of heat by direct contact between particles of matter
conductor material that transfers heat or electricity easily
insulator poor conductor of heat or electricity
convection circulation of heat through liquid/gas by movement of particles.
melt change form form a solid to a liquid
evaporate change form from liquid to gas
condense change form from gas to a liquid
freeze change form from liquid to solid
potential energy energy that object has becaus of position or structure, stored energy
kinetic energy energy that something has because of its motion
joule basic unit of energy and of work
